How much does an Engineering Manager earn in Kennewick, WA?

The average engineering manager in Kennewick, WA earns between $101,000 and $205,000 annually. This compares to the national average engineering manager range of $99,000 to $195,000.

Average Engineering Manager Salary In Kennewick, WA

$144,000
